Life with a man is more businesslike after it, and money matters work better. And then, you see, if you have rows, and he turns you out of doors, you can get the law to protect you, which you can't otherwise, unless he half-runs you through with a knife, or cracks your noddle with a poker. And if he bolts away from you–I say it friendly, as woman to woman, for there's never any knowing what a man med do– you'll have the sticks o' furniture, and won't be looked upon as a thief.

Thomas Hardy, Jude the Obscure
